Bomb hoax delays train

Published December 21, 2008

MULTAN, Dec 20: A bomb hoax delayed departure of Lahore-bound Karakoram Express by 90 minutes on Saturday.

Reports said the train left Karachi on Friday and arrived at Lodhran at 4:25pm on Saturday, 12 hours behind its scheduled time. A rumour was doing the rounds among the passengers that a bomb had been planted in the train. However, police and bomb disposal squad after a thorough search at Lodhran cleared the train. Passengers were allowed to board the train after scanning. The search delayed the train further.

According to our Faisalabad correspondent, a red alert was declared at the local railway station following a bomb hoax in Karakoram Express.

Bomb disposal squad and civil defence teams reached the station and combed the Chiltan and Millat Express before their departure.—Staff Correspondent
